Transforming Your Life with Yoga: 10 Surprising Benefits
Embarking on a yoga journey can be one of the most rewarding decisions you make for your overall well-being. As someone deeply immersed in the world of yoga, both as a practitioner and an instructor, I've seen the remarkable ways in which this ancient practice can revolutionize lives. This article delves into ten surprising benefits of yoga that go beyond conventional expectations, offering insights and practical advice to enhance your practice and life.
1. Heightened Intuition
Yoga fosters a deep connection with your inner self, enhancing your intuition. As you become more attuned to your body and mind, you'll notice an increased ability to make decisions that are in harmony with your true self. This can lead to more authentic choices in various aspects of life, from career moves to personal relationships.
2. Aging Gracefully
Yoga's impact on the aging process is profound. Regular practice promotes flexibility, strength, and vitality, helping to keep the body youthful and energetic. Moreover, the stress-reducing benefits of yoga can also contribute to a more radiant complexion and a vibrant presence.
3. Enhanced Digestive Function
The physical movements in yoga, particularly twists and forward bends, massage internal organs and improve digestive function. Many yogis report improvements in digestion and metabolism, which contribute to better energy levels and a reduction in bloating and other digestive issues.
4. Increased self-esteem
Yoga is a journey of self-discovery and self-acceptance. As you progress in your practice, overcoming challenges and mastering new poses, you'll likely experience a significant boost in self-esteem. This newfound confidence can translate into various aspects of your life, empowering you to embrace new opportunities and challenges.
5. Emotional healing
Yoga provides a safe space to explore and release pent-up emotions. Practices like hip openers and heart openers can be particularly effective in releasing emotional baggage. Many practitioners find yoga to be a therapeutic tool that complements other forms of emotional healing.
6. Enhanced Sexual Health
Yoga can improve your sexual life by increasing flexibility, reducing stress, and enhancing body awareness. Certain poses increase blood flow to the pelvic region, enhancing sexual function and increasing desire. Plus, the confidence gained from regular practice can translate into improved intimacy and connection with your partner.
7. Improved posture and alignment
Regular yoga practice strengthens the muscles around the spine and improves posture. This not only enhances your appearance but also reduces the risk of back pain and other musculoskeletal issues. Improved posture also contributes to better breathing and digestion.
8. Detoxification
Yoga aids in detoxifying the body by stimulating the lymphatic system, enhancing circulation, and promoting sweating. This natural detoxification process can improve your energy levels, skin health, and overall vitality.
9. Enhanced Problem-Solving Skills
The meditative aspects of yoga can improve cognitive function, particularly in areas related to problem-solving and creativity. By calming the mind and reducing mental clutter, yoga allows for clearer thinking and more effective decision-making.
10. A Path to Spiritual Growth
For those inclined, yoga offers a path to spiritual exploration and growth. The practice encourages a deeper connection with the self and the universe, fostering a sense of peace, contentment, and oneness that can be profoundly transformative.
Yoga is more than just a physical practice; it's a comprehensive approach to well-being that can transform your life in myriad unexpected ways. Whether you're a novice or an experienced yogi, embracing these aspects of yoga can lead to profound personal growth and fulfillment.
